I need a web developer who can work with the steam api for the game, Dota 2.
Essentially, I need someone to develop a website almost identical to this one:
[login to view URL]
Except dota edge uses a rating system. I want this website to use actual history of match statistics, much like dotaBUFF website:
[login to view URL]
If you are unfamiliar with Dota 2, it is a real time strategy type game that puts 5 "heroes" (ie game characters) in a battle against another 5 heroes. There is a set pool of around 110 heroes, and each team has the opportunity to select which heroes they want at the start of the game. The dotaBUFF website uses the dota 2 steam api and match history to determine the individual matchups for a hero. If you click on any hero on dotabuff, and click matchups, you can see the percentage "advantage" and "win rate" between that hero and every other hero (example: [login to view URL]). What i want my website to do is essentially a more complex version that does the same thing for 5v5 scenarios. Im not sure whether this would be done analysing other matches where those exact 5 heroes were playing on a team (probably the best way), or using the win rate for 1v1 matchups between suggested heroes and each of the 5 heroes the other team has picked.
So, the user would enter 1-5 heroes that the enemy team has already picked. Then click run (or more beneficially, automatically update using jquery or something similar), and it would analyse the enemy heroes, and list the best heroes to pick as a counter, in order of win rate (or advantage), based on the statistics obtained from the match histories in the dota 2 api. Obviously it would need to be able to analyse a reasonably large sample size to get a reliable result.
Part of the job is setting up the website and the basic design. It can look similar to dotaedge. The functionality of the website does not have to be any more than dota edge (select 1-5 heroes, then it provides a list of counters), except the aforementioned fact that the results are based on the dota 2 api statistics. It should also have some provision to add new heroes if/when they are brought out, in a way that isnt too complicated.
When bidding please provide some sort of example of a similar project you have done before.
Hi,
Please give me opportunity to work for you.I have expertise in website design and development.
I have review your project description, I can build website for you as per your requirement and also I will give you high quality and fast work.
you can review my work and quality from my portfolio, I will show you more once you will select me.
I am very interested in your project an also I am ready to start immediately.
Hope for your very soon reply
Thanks & Regards
jnaki
Hello Sir,
Thank you very much for giving me Bidding Opportunity..
We have read your job description carefully..We are expert in PSD/HTML/PHP/Wordpress…So we are ready to start your job..If you have any question please ask me fill free…
Thank you - S.G